Tractor march from Delhi borders on January 26 to be peaceful, says Rajewal

The farmer leader says efforts are being made to malign the agitation

New Delhi, January 14

Ahead of the January 15 talks with the government, farmer leader Balbir Singh Rajewal on Thursday said efforts are being made to malign the agitation.

He urged everyone to maintain peace on January 26, when the farmers intend to hold a parallel parade. 

Currently, there is speculation on social media that the farmers' tractor march will be on the Delhi roads, including the Rajpath. Rajewal said the tractor march would be held from the Delhi borders, and that rumours were being spread to malign the agitation.

Urging farmers to maitain peace and harmony, he said the outline for the march would be formalised and conveyed to the farmers, who were advised against issuing statements on the issue.

“We will carry out a tractor parade from the Delhi borders. The details of the march will be finalised soon, he said. 

Not only social media but a section of the agitating farmers also has been claiming that they will hoist the Tricolour at the Red Fort on Republic Day and march on the Delhi roads towards Parliament. 

Rajewal told The Tribune that the tractor march would be peaceful and the outline of the programme would be decided after the meeting with the Union ministers on Friday.
